Jay boys tankers remain perfect

Jay County middle school swimming

One day after beating Muncie Northside by 74 points, the Jay County middle school boys swim team swam past Adams Central, 182-105.
The girls squad also won, 184-118.
Alex LeMaster paved the way for the boys, winning both the 100-yard individual medley and 100 breaststroke.
Christopher McDowell placed first in the 100 freestyle, and Cody Moser earned the top spot in diving.
Moser and LeMaster also teamed up with Tayler Smeltzer and Noah Hummel to win the 200 freestyle relay.

Dual event winners for the girls were Elizabeth McDowell (100 IM and 100 backstroke), Erica Hathaway (100 and 200 freestyle) and Alex Bader (50 and 400 freestyle).
Kaitlyn Dow (50 butterfly), Breea Liette (100 breaststroke) and Courtney Miles (diving) won their respective events.
Bader, Dow and McDowell teamed up with Liette to win the 200 medley relay, and the trio joined Hathaway to take first in the 400 freestyle relay.
Liette and Hathaway also joined Kaitlyn Hicks and Miles to win the 200 freestyle relay.
The boys improve to 4-0 on the season, and the girls pushed their record to 3-1.[[In-content Ad]]
